Mental Health Services in Colorado Springs, Colorado

Nestled at the base of the stunning Rocky Mountains, Colorado Springs, Colorado is the state's second-largest city, offering a rich blend of outdoor activities, cultural experiences, and a growing tech industry. Despite its picturesque setting, mental health concerns are a reality for many of its over 450,000 residents.

Key Mental-Health Concerns for Colorado Springs Residents

Common conditions include anxiety, depression, and post-traumatic stress disorder (PTSD), particularly among the city's significant military population. According to the CDC, Colorado has higher rates of suicide and substance abuse than the national average, further highlighting the need for accessible mental health services.

Access to Care & Providers in Colorado Springs

Residents seeking therapy in Colorado Springs, Colorado have a range of options, including private practices, community health centers, and telehealth services. The city is also home to several crisis hotlines and veteran-specific mental health resources. Recent initiatives have aimed to improve access to care, particularly among underserved communities.

Therapies & Specialties

  •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) and Dialectical Behavior Therapy (DBT) are widely available in Colorado Springs, Colorado.
  • Given the city's military presence, many providers specialize in Eye Movement Desensitization and Reprocessing (EMDR) and trauma-focused care.
  • Unique local offerings include e-therapy, bilingual care, and veteran support services.

Local Policies & Stressors

While Colorado Springs boasts a lower cost of living than the national average, economic pressures like housing affordability can contribute to mental health stress. The city's tech industry growth, while beneficial to the economy, may increase work-related stress among residents.
